TIES478 Linux-virtuaalipalvelimen ylläpito

Kevät 2018

Huom. Luentokalvoja ei ole suunniteltu itseopiskelumateriaaliksi, vaikka niistä pitäisikin saada kuva siitä mitä pitäisi oppia. Jos ei ehdi luennoille, asioita pitää kokeilla ja etsiä itse tietoa netistä.

Luento 1 kalvot (odp) (pdf) (html): kurssin suorituksesta ja sisällöstä, Linux/palvelin/virtuaali-, virtuaalikone/kontti/virtual host, ylläpito...
Luento 2 kalvot (odp) (pdf) (html): verkkoalueet, virt-install, virsh, levyt ja osiointi, tiedostojärjestelmät, käyttäjien hallinta
Luento 3 kalvot (odp) (pdf) (html): tiedostojen ominaisuuksista, levy täyttyy..., virtuaalisen kovalevyn lisäys
Luento 4 kalvot (odp) (pdf) (html): virt-install oikeudet/levyformaatit/etäkäyttö, image-varmuuskopio, eval, loop device, levyn suurentaminen, Ubuntun päivitys, for-loop, redirection, grub, run levels, startup/shutdown
Demo1
Luento 5 kalvot (odp) (pdf) (html): ssh, scp, lighttpd, busybox
Luento 6 kalvot (odp) (pdf) (html): konsolit, asennusongelmia, /usr lost, dd, cron, at, batch
Demo2
Luento 7 kalvot (odp) (pdf) (html): LVM
Demo3
Luento 8 kalvot (odp) (pdf) (html): inodes, fsck, tune2fs, tiedostojärjestelmän pienentäminen, VM:n valvonta, recovery mode, single-user mode, LVM recovery, ftp
Luento 9 kalvot (odp) (pdf) (html): chroot, DNS, regular expressions, grep, sed, chmod, umask
Demo4
Luento 10 kalvot (odp) (pdf) (html): reititys, ssh forwarding, lost initramfs recovery
Luento 11 kalvot (odp) (pdf) (html): nginx, shell skripteistä, levyongelmia, Kerberos-ongelmia
Demo5
Luento 12 kalvot (odp) (pdf) (html): NFS, iptables
Luento 13 kalvot (odp) (pdf) (html): telnet, nmap, traceroute, iptables, automounter
Demo6
Demo7
Luento 14 kalvot (odp) (pdf) (html): SSL ja sertifikaatit, levyn salaus, RAID, identd, inetd, tcp_wrappers
Luento 15 kalvot (odp) (pdf) (html): Oman koneen ylläpito, dmesg/journalctl/rsyslog, levytila loppu -checklist, palvelu X ei toimi -checklist

iptables-esimerkki
monimutkaisempi iptables-esimerkki (skripti)
yksinkertainen iptables tyhjennysskripti
vaihtoehtoinen iptables tyhjennysskripti
perusteellinen iptables tyhjennysskripti

FAQ

Hyväksytty suoritus tekemällä kaikki demot hyväksytysti sekä läpäisemällä konetentin (arvostelu siis hyväksytty/hylätty).

Kurssi vaatii läsnäoloa, demoja ei ole mahdollista suorittaa etänä. Myöskään tenttiä ei ole mahdollista suorittaa etänä, joten tarkista aikataulujen sopivuus. Demot ovat riippuvaisia edellisistä, joten niiden suorittaminen järjestyksessä on välttämätöntä.